1.Analysis of Quality Changes of Small Packaged Alismatis Rhizoma Decoction Pieces Under Different Packaging and Storage Conditions
Gaoting YANG ; Rui XIAN ; Zimin WANG ; Zongyi ZHAO ; Zhiqiong LAN ; Xiaoli PAN ; Min LI
Chinese Journal of Experimental Traditional Medical Formulae 2026;32(2):179-188
ObjectiveTo screen suitable packaging and storage conditions for small packaged Alismatis Rhizoma decoction pieces, laying the foundation for developing standardized storage, maintenance techniques and determining shelf life. MethodsUsing the accelerated stability test method, the small packaged decoction pieces of Alismatis Rhizoma were placed in polyethylene plastic bags, aluminum foil polyethylene composite bags, and cowhide coated paper bags under temperature of (40±2) ℃ and relative humidity of (75±5)% conditions, the quality testing was conducted at the end of the 0th, 1st, 2nd, 3rd, and 6th month, respectively. Using long-term stability test method, an orthogonal experiment was designed to investigate storage conditions, packaging materials, and packaging methods. At the end of the 0th, 1st, 3rd, 6th, 9th, 12th, 18th, and 24th month, the quality of small packaged Alismatis Rhizoma decoction pieces was tested under different packaging and storage conditions(including 2 packaging methods:vacuum packaging and sealed packaging, 3 storage conditions:room temperature, cool, and modified atmosphere, 3 packaging materials:cowhide coated paper bag, aluminum foil polyethylene composite bag, and polyethylene plastic bag). Then, the G1-entropy weight method combined with orthogonal experiment was used to analyze the quality changes of the decoction pieces under different packaging and storage conditions to identify optimal packaging and storage conditions. The quality testing indicators for Alismatis Rhizoma decoction pieces were expanded beyond those specified in the 2020 edition of the Pharmacopoeia of the People's Republic of China. In addition to the existing indicators(characteristics, moisture content, extractives, and the total content of 23-acetyl alisol B and 23-acetyl alisol C), new indicators including color value, water activity, total triterpenoid content, and alisol B content have been added. ResultsThe accelerated stability test results indicated that the quality of small packaged Alismatis Rhizoma decoction pieces was more stable when packaged in aluminum foil-polyethylene composite materials compared to cowhide-coated paper bags and polyethylene plastic bags. Analysis of the long-term stability test results using the G1-entropy weight method combined with orthogonal experiment revealed that storage conditions had the greatest impact on both raw and salt-processed products, followed by packaging materials, while the packaging method had the least influence. For both types of small packaged Alismatis Rhizoma decoction pieces, modified atmosphere storage demonstrated superior efficacy compared to cool storage or room temperature storage. Storage in aluminum foil-polyethylene composite bags was superior to polyethylene plastic bags or cowhide-coated paper bags. However, the stability of sealed raw products was better than vacuum-packed ones, whereas vacuum-packed salt-processed products exhibited greater stability than their sealed counterparts. ConclusionBased on the results of the quality changes of small packaged Alismatis Rhizoma decoction pieces under different storage conditions, it is recommended that the suitable storage packaging conditions for small packaged raw products are sealed packaging with aluminum foil polyethylene composite bags and controlled atmosphere storage, and the suitable storage and packaging conditions for small packaged salt-processed products are vacuum packaging with aluminum foil polyethylene composite bags and controlled atmosphere storage.
2.Impact of wearable devices in assisting disease monitoring on heart-focused anxiety in patients with tachyarrhythmias
Yuying LI ; Xinyue DONG ; Zhiyun SHEN ; Xian ZHANG ; Caiying YANG ; Yuxuan HUANG ; Meiqiong YAN
Chinese Journal of Clinical Medicine 2026;33(3):445-451
Objective To explore the impact of wearable devices in assisting disease monitoring on heart-focused anxiety in patients with tachyarrhythmias. Methods A cross-sectional study design was conducted. 305 patients with tachyarrhythmias who attended the department of cardiology of Zhongshan Hospital, Fudan University in Shanghai from July 2025 to December 2025 were enrolled as the research subjects, and clinical data of patients were collected. Univariate analysis and multiple stepwise regression analysis were used to analyze the impact of wearable devices in assisting disease monitoring on patients’ heart-focused anxiety. Results The mean score of heart-focused anxiety in the 305 patients with tachyarrhythmias was 33.16±9.70. Among them, 104(34.10%) patients used wearable devices in assisting disease monitoring. The results of univariate analysis and multiple stepwise regression showed that the use of wearable devices in assisting disease monitoring was an influencing factor for heart-focused anxiety (P<0.05), and the patients who used wearable devices in assisting disease monitoring had a significantly lower level of heart-focused anxiety (P<0.05). Conclusions The use of wearable devices in assisting disease monitoring is associated with a lower level of heart-focused anxiety in patients with tachyarrhythmias. Medical staff can guide patients to rationally use wearable devices in assisting disease monitoring on the basis of evaluating their needs and device operation capabilities.
3.Chinese expert consensus on salvage esophagectomy for esophageal cancer after definitive chemoradiotherapy
Zhaoxian LIN ; Yang HU ; Lei XIAN ; Yun LI ; Jinbo ZHAO ; Xiaobin HOU ; Shuangping ZHANG ; Sunkui KE ; Changying GUO ; Songping XIE ; Haitao WEI ; Yong LI
Chinese Journal of Clinical Thoracic and Cardiovascular Surgery 2026;33(07):977-987
Definitive chemoradiotherapy (dCRT) has become a cornerstone in the treatment of locally advanced esophageal cancer; however, local control remains suboptimal, and persistent lesions or locoregional recurrences after treatment are not uncommon. For patients without distant metastases but with local failure, whether surgical intervention can still offer curative potential remains a major clinical dilemma. Salvage esophagectomy (SE) offers potential long-term survival for selected patients, but this procedure is performed in the context of severe fibrosis, impaired local blood supply, and obscured anatomical planes following chemoradiotherapy, resulting in significantly higher perioperative risk compared to primary esophagectomy. Consequently, controversies exist regarding patient selection, preoperative restaging, choice of surgical approach, extent of lymphadenectomy, gastrointestinal reconstruction, and perioperative management. In recent years, with the refinement of restaging modalities such as PET/CT, the accumulation of experience in high-volume centers, and emerging evidence from clinical studies, the clinical role of SE has gradually shifted from a "high-risk salvage measure" to a "selective curative strategy aimed at achieving long-term survival in carefully selected patients". Nevertheless, standardized guidelines for patient selection, technical approaches, and perioperative management are still lacking. Based on current evidence and clinical experience, experts organized by the Integrated Esophageal Cancer Committee of Chinese Anti-Cancer Association systematically reviewed key issues regarding SE, including its definition, indications, preoperative evaluation, choice of surgical approach, lymphadenectomy, gastrointestinal reconstruction, and perioperative management, and formulated a Chinese expert consensus. This consensus aims to provide guidance for standardized assessment, appropriate referral, individualized surgical decision-making, and optimized perioperative management of patients with locoregional failure after dCRT. Ultimately, this will increase the likelihood of R0 resection, reduce the risk of severe complications, and promote the safer, more judicious, and standardized implementation of SE in high-risk scenarios.
4.Stress analysis of computer aided design/computer aided manufacture post-core materials with different elastic moduli
Liangwei XU ; Xitian TIAN ; Lin CHEN ; Hongyan GAO ; Xian ZHU ; Guican YANG ; Yinghao CHEN
Chinese Journal of Tissue Engineering Research 2025;29(10):2061-2066
BACKGROUND:Post and core restoration is a common choice for tooth defects,but the repair effects of various post and core materials are different. OBJECTIVE:To evaluate the stress distribution at the post and core,tooth root,and bonding agent site of post and core models made of different elastic modulus post and core materials using finite element method. METHODS:A three-dimensional root canal treated maxillary central incisor model was built using three-dimensional modeling software,which was restored with a full ceramic crown.The post and core materials in the restoration used nanoceramic resin(elastic modulus=12.8 GPa),composite resin(elastic modulus=16 GPa),hybrid ceramic(elastic modulus=34.7 GPa),glass ceramic(elastic modulus=95 GPa),titanium alloy(elastic modulus=112 GPa),and zirconia(elastic modulus=209.3 GPa).The model was fixed in cortical bone.A 100 N concentrated force of 45° from the long axis of the tooth was applied to 1/3 of the crown and tongue side of the central incisor.The stress distribution of the post and core,dentin,and tooth-root bonding agent in the model was repaired by the maximum principal stress criterion. RESULTS AND CONCLUSION:(1)When the post and core materials with higher elastic modulus was used,the post-core stress in the repair model was more concentrated.When the elastic modulus of the post and core materials(nanoceramic resin and composite resin)was close to dentin,the stress distribution of the post and core was more uniform.The stress distribution of dentin in all restoration models was similar regardless of post and core materials.When the post and core with higher elastic modulus was used,more stress concentration was shown at the post and root bonding agent in the repair model.(2)The maximum stress values at the post and core,tooth root,and the bonding agent site of post and tooth root in the nanoceramic resin model were 31.00,33.21,and 0.51 MPa,respectively.The maximum stress values at the post and core,tooth root,and the bonding agent between the post and tooth root in the composite resin model were 36.84,33.14,and 0.59 MPa,respectively.In the mixed ceramic model,the maximum stress values at the post and core,tooth root,and the bonding agent between the post and tooth root were 64.05,32.83,and 1.00 MPa,respectively.In the glass ceramic model,the maximum stress values at the post and core,tooth root,and the bonding agent between the post and tooth root were 112.30,32.69,and 1.73 MPa,respectively.In the titanium alloy model,the maximum stress values of the post and core,tooth root,and the bonding agent between the post and tooth root were 120.00,32.17,and 1.86 MPa,respectively.In the zirconia model,the maximum stress values of the post and core,tooth root,and the bonding agent between the post and tooth root were 148.80,31.85,and 2.28 MPa,respectively.(3)The higher the elastic modulus of the post and core material,the higher the maximum stress at the post and core during restoration.The elastic modulus of the post and core material had no significant effect on the maximum stress of the dental bonding agent and dentin.
5.Study on the evaluation index system for cough and wheeze pharmacist competency training based on the layered learning practice model
Yuan LI ; Xian YANG ; Simin YAN ; Li LI
China Pharmacy 2025;36(11):1389-1393
OBJECTIVE To develop the quality evaluation standard indicator system for hospital cough and wheeze pharmaceutical care clinic (CWPC) pharmacist training within the layered learning practice model (LLPM), and apply it in clinical practice. METHODS Our teaching team established an LLPM model to train cough and wheeze pharmacists, according to the actual conditions of our college. Using qualitative interview methods, expert questionnaires were compiled with literature research; the expert correspondence methods were employed to conduct two rounds of consultation with 10 domestic respiratory medicine experts, thus constructing an evaluation index system for the teaching quality of cough and wheeze pharmacists. The experts’ positive coefficient, authority coefficient, Kendall’s harmony coefficient, and the degree of concentration of opinions were calculated. The analytic hierarchy process (AHP) was used to determine the weight of each indicator within the index system. From June 2023 to June 2024, the teaching team enrolled 21 pharmacists in the training program. The teaching team assessed and scored the trial group (LLPM) and control group (traditional teaching model) based on the benefit indicators for pharmacists and patients in the evaluation index system, and compared the results. RESULTS This study explored the establishment of a training system for cough and wheeze pharmacists under the LLPM model, and initially established an evaluation index system using the Delphi method. In two rounds of Delphi method questionnaires, the recovery rate was 100%, with an authority coefficient exceeding 0.8, Kendall’s harmony coefficient ranging from 0.235 to 0.459, and all P-values being less than 0.05. Four primary (comprising trainee feedback, learning gains, behavioral improvements, and training performance), 12 secondary and 33 tertiary indicators were finalized. In the empirical evaluation, the results of the two groups showed a significant benefit to the pharmacists in the trial group. Specifically, the percentage of patients receiving corticosteroids for COPD or wheeze service patients per month (80.5%), an average increase in the number of cough and wheeze team service outpatient visits per month (compared to the same period of the previous year) of 14.8 visits per month, and the patient satisfaction score (4.9) were all significantly higher than those in the control group (P<0.05). CONCLUSIONS The application of the LLPM in competency training for pharmacists specializing in cough and wheeze care yields multiple benefits and holds significant guiding value. The constructed training quality evaluation index system under this model is scientific and reliable.
6.Study on the Expression of Serum miR-16a,miR-15b Levels and Their Clinical Diagnostic and Prognostic Value in Neonatal Early-onset Sepsis Patients
Jing WANG ; Zhonghui YANG ; Xian WANG ; Jing LU ; Shuo LIANG
Journal of Modern Laboratory Medicine 2025;40(5):73-77
Objective To investigate the expression of serum microRNA(miR)-16a and mir-15b in patients with early-onset neonatal sepsis(EONS)and its value in clinical diagnosis and prognosis evaluation.Methods 114 children diagnosed with EONS admitted to the Department of Neonatology,Baoding Hospital of Beijing Children's Hospital Affiliated to Capital Medical University from October 2020 to October 2023 were selected as the EONS group,and 114 healthy newborns in the hospital during the same period were selected as the control group.Follow up was conducted on all EONS patients for a period of 6 months,including 34 cases in the poor prognosis group and 80 cases in the good prognosis group.The relative expression levels of miR-16a and miR-15b were measured within 6h of admission using real-time fluorescence quamtitative PCR(qRT-PCR).ROC curve was applied to analyze the diagnostic and prognostic value of serum miR-16a and miR-15b for EONS.Multivariate Logistic regression was applied to analyze the factors that affected the poor prognosis of EONS.Results Compared with the reference group,the birth weight of children in the EONS group(3.44±0.35kg/m2 vs 3.89±0.40kg/m2)was obviously reduced,and there was a obvious difference(35/114,1/114)in pathological jaundice between the two groups,and the differences were statistically significant(t=9.040,χ2=35.922,all P<0.05).Compared with the reference group,the serum levels of miR-16a and miR-15b in the EONS group were obviously increased,and the differences was statistically significant(t=7.699,8.606,all P<0.05).The area under the curve(AUC)of the ROC curve for the combined diagnosis of EONS by serum miR-16a and miR-15b was higher than that of miR-16a and miR-15b alone,and the differences were statistically significant(Z=2.619,2.157,all P<0.05).Compared with the good prognosis group,the poor prognosis group had a obvious decrease in body weight at birth,and a obvious increase in serum levels of miR-16a and miR-15b,and the differences were statistically significant(t=5.434,6.308,all P<0.05).The AUC of serum miR-16a and miR-15b combined for prognostic evaluation was higher than that of miR-16a and miR-15b evaluated separately,and the differences were statistically significant(Z=2.364,2.073,all P<0.05).Birth weight,miR-16a,miR-15b expression level was a prognostic factor of EONS(Wald χ2=33.459,16.146,49.797,all P<0.05).Conclusion MiR-16a and miR-15b are highly expressed in the serum of children with EONS,and they have certain diagnostic and prognostic value for EONS.
7.Value of Red Blood Cell Distribution Width Combined With BISAP Score in Early Prediction of Severe Acute Pancreatitis
Xian TU ; Yan LIU ; Chunyan YANG ; Yan SHEN ; Yiqing WANG ; Deqiong CHEN ; Qi JI ; Qingming WU
Chinese Journal of Gastroenterology 2025;30(1):9-15
Background:The incidence and mortality rates of severe acute pancreatitis(SAP)have been increasing year by year.Therefore,early and rapid identification,along with timely intervention in the progression of acute pancreatitis(AP),is of particular importance.Aims:To explore the value of red blood cell distribution width(RDW)combined with BISAP score in the early prediction of SAP.Methods:A total of 561 AP patients admitted from January 2019 to December 2021 at the General Hospital of the Central Theater Command of the PLA were enrolled and divided into SAP group and non-SAP group according to the disease severity.Venous blood samples were collected within 24 hours of admission.The relevant clinical data,laboratory indices,BISAP score,and MCTSI score were compared between the two groups.Logistic regression analysis was used to identify the risk factors for SAP.Spearman correlation coefficient was employed to assess the correlation of these risk factors with the severity of AP,as well as the correlation of RDW with BISAP score and MCTSI score.The predictive values of these risk factors for SAP were evaluated by ROC curve analysis.Results:Compared with the non-SAP group,the prevalence of hypertension,length and cost of hospital stay,neutrophil count(NEUT),neutrophil-to-lymphocyte ratio(NLR),RDW,serum potassium,aspartate transaminase(AST),blood urea nitrogen(BUN),serum creatinine(SCr),BISAP score and MCTSI score were significantly increased in the SAP group(all P<0.05),while the lymphocyte count(LYM),serum calcium and albumin(ALB)were significantly decreased(all P<0.05).RDW(OR=1.582,95%CI:1.066-2.348,P=0.023),SCr(OR=1.018,95%CI:1.001-1.035,P=0.040),BISAP score(OR=6.210,95%CI:3.121-12.356,P<0.001),and MCTSI score(OR=2.917,95%CI:2.160-3.939,P<0.001)were the independent risk factors for SAP.RDW(rs=0.320,P<0.001),SCr(rs=0.103,P=0.015),BISAP score(rs=0.516,P<0.001),and MCTSI score(rs=0.512,P<0.001)were positively correlated with the severity of AP.Moreover,RDW was positively correlated with BISAP score(rs=0.428,P<0.001)and MCTSI score(rs=0.408,P<0.001).ROC curve analysis revealed that the areas under the ROC curve of RDW,SCr,BISAP score,MCTSI score,and combination of RDW and BISAP score for predicting SAP were 0.753,0.581,0.889,0.888,and 0.905,respectively.Conclusions:RDW,SCr,BISAP score,and MCTSI score are the independent risk factors for SAP.RDW combined with BISAP score can enhance the predictive value for SAP.
8.Association of Residual Cholesterol and Type 2 Diabetes and its Mechanism of Action
Li-xian ZHAO ; Jing ZHOU ; Yang WANG ; Juan LI ; Xiao-hai LI
Progress in Modern Biomedicine 2025;25(16):2715-2720
Type 2 diabetes(T2DM)was a chronic metabolic disease,vascular lesions was one of the common complications of T2DM,including microvascular and macrovascular lesions,which seriously threatens the health of patients and increases the risk of disability and death.Dyslipidemia was one of the pathogenesis of type 2 diabetes,the disorder of lipid metabolism was also closely related to various acute and chronic complications of diabetes,the cholesterol in the lipoproteins rich in triglycerides(TG)was known as residual cholesterol.Existing studies have shown that,residual cholesterol was closely related to the occurrence and development of vascular lesions in T2DM.Residual cholesterol may be involved in T2DM vascular lesions through mediating inflammatory response,participating in oxidative stress,lipid metabolism disorder and direct damage to vascular endothelial function.This study reviewed the association between residual cholesterol and T2DM vascular lesions and its mechanism of action in T2DM vascular lesions,aiming to provide solid theoretical support for the formulation of prevention and treatment strategies for T2DM vascular lesions.
9.The impact of county-level"Unified ECG Network"construction on the treatment efficiency and clinical outcomes of patients with acute ST-segment elevation myocardial infarction
Ting-qiao YE ; Heng YANG ; Tao JIANG ; Min DAI ; Yu LI ; Qiang LI ; Xian-hua YANG ; Yuan-bao LI
Chinese Journal of Interventional Cardiology 2025;33(10):561-567
Objective To investigate the impact of county-level"Unified ECG Network"construction on the treatment efficiency and clinical outcomes of patients with acute ST-segment elevation myocardial infarction(STEMI).Methods A retrospective analysis was conducted on the clinical data of STEMI patients from Beichuan County and Yanting County in Mianyang City,and Jiange County in Guangyuan City,Sichuan Province,during the 18 months before(128 cases)and 18 months after(187 cases)the establishment of the"Unified ECG Network."Differences in demographic characteristics,treatment efficiency,therapeutic methods,and clinical outcomes between the two groups were compared.Results There was no statistically significant difference in general demographic characteristics between the two groups(all P>0.05).Compared with the pre-construction group,the post-construction group showed significantly shorter times in initial ECG completion[5(3,7)min vs.6(4,8)min],initial ECG diagnosis[3(2,4)min vs.5(2,6)min],first medical contact to preliminary diagnosis[10(9,12)min vs.13(11,15)min],network hospital door-in-door-out time[21(19,23)min vs.26(23,30)min],and first medical contact to wire-crossing time[(94.82±11.87)min vs.(107.97±18.39)min](allP<0.001).The proportion of patients bypassing the emergency department and coronary care unit significantly increased(64.17%vs.32.81%,P<0.001).The proportion of patients undergoing emergency percutaneous coronary intervention significantly increased(72.73%vs.51.56%,P<0.001),while the proportions of thrombolytic therapy and non-reperfusion therapy significantly decreased(both P<0.05).Additionally,in-hospital mortality rate,Killip class≥Ⅱ proportion,incidence of major adverse cardiovascular events,and average length of hospital stay were all significantly reduced(all P<0.05).There were no statistically significant differences among the three county-level chest pain centers in terms of major treatment efficiency,therapeutic strategies,or clinical outcomes(all P>0.05).Conclusions The construction of the county-level"Unified ECG Network"can significantly improve the treatment efficiency of STEMI patients,optimize reperfusion therapy strategies,improve clinical outcomes,and demonstrate substantial clinical promotion value.
10.Analysis of proportion and trend prediction of disability-adjusted life years attributed to aging population in common diges-tive system malignant tumors in China
Ji LI ; Yang CHEN ; Maorong ZHANG ; Zhao YANG ; Xian TANG ; Hongmei WEN
Practical Oncology Journal 2025;39(5):372-380
Objective The aim of this study was to analyze the proportion of disability adjusted life years(DALYs)attributed to aging population in common digestive system malignancies in China,and predict the proportion and the trends of DALYs attributed to aging proportion from 2022 to 2046.Methods Based on the Global Burden of Disease Study 2021,the DALY data of esophageal cancer,stomach cancer,colorectal cancer,pancreatic cancer,liver cancer,gallbladder and biliary tract cancer of Chinese people aged≥25 years from 1990 to 2021 were selected.The age-period-birth models were used to predict the DALY of malignant tumors from 2022 to 2046.The changes of DALY from 1990 to 2046 were decomposed into population growth,population aging,and age-specific DALY rate changes,and analyze the proportion of DALY changes attributable to population aging and its change trend.Results From 1990 to 2021,the DALY change rates of esophageal cancer,stomach cancer,colorectal cancer,pancreatic cancer,liver cancer,gall-bladder and biliary tract cancer in Chinese people aged≥25 years were 18.20%,-0.34%,98.10%,164.16%,58.21%and 90.62%,respectively.Compared with 2021,the proportion of DALY changes attributed to population aging for six types of malignant tumors in 1990 was from-38.32%to-19.72%.The top three cancer types with the highest attribution ratios were stomach cancer(-38.32%),esophageal cancer(-38.07%),gallbladder and biliary tract cancer(-29.78%).The expected change rates of DALY for the six types of malignant tumors from 2021 to 2046 were 20.72%,11.50%,58.19%,57.38%,21.36%and 48.39%,respective-ly.By compared with 2021,the proportion of DALY changes of six malignant tumors attributed to population aging in 2046 was from 18.82%to 47.83%,and the top three cancers attributed to the proportion were gallbladder and biliary tract cancer(47.83%),color-ectal cancer(43.07%)and pancreatic cancer(38.76%).From 2022 to 2046,the proportion of DALY changes attributed to aging pop-ulation for the six types of malignant tumors would continue to rise(P<0.001).The proportions of colorectal cancer and pancreatic cancer attributed to population aging and the proportion of age-specific DALY rate were both positive and rising(P<0.001),which would eventually promote the further increase of DALY.Conclusion Population aging has become the main driving factor for the growth of DALY in digestive system malignant tumors in China.The impact on DALY of colorectal cancer and pancreatic cancer will be prominent in the future.Targeted prevention and control strategies should be developed to actively respond to population aging.
